The maritime industry plays a crucial role in global trade, and one of the essential components of ship design is the ballast water tank. A ballast water tank is a compartment within a ship that holds water to provide stability and balance while sailing. Ships are often heavy and large, which makes them susceptible to tipping over, especially when they are not loaded with cargo. Therefore, the ballast water tank serves an important purpose by allowing ships to adjust their weight distribution and maintain an even keel. When a ship is at sea, it may encounter rough waters or strong winds that can affect its stability. By filling the ballast water tank with water, the ship's center of gravity is lowered, which helps to counteract the forces acting upon it. This is particularly important during transit, as cargo vessels may face unpredictable weather conditions. Proper management of the ballast water tank is critical for ensuring the safety of the vessel and its crew.In addition to stability, ballast water tanks also play a role in environmental protection. When ships take on water in one port and discharge it in another, they can inadvertently transfer aquatic species from one ecosystem to another. This practice can lead to the introduction of invasive species, which can disrupt local marine environments. To address this issue, international regulations have been established to manage ballast water tanks and minimize the ecological impact of ballast water discharge.The Ballast Water Management Convention, adopted by the International Maritime Organization (IMO), sets standards for the treatment and management of ballast water. Ships are required to implement effective systems to treat their ballast water tanks before discharging the water back into the ocean. This includes using filtration, ultraviolet light, or chemical treatments to eliminate harmful organisms and pathogens. Compliance with these regulations is vital for protecting marine biodiversity and ensuring sustainable shipping practices.Furthermore, advancements in technology have led to the development of innovative solutions for managing ballast water tanks. Modern ships are now equipped with sophisticated systems that monitor and control the intake and discharge of ballast water. These systems not only enhance the efficiency of ballast water tank operations but also ensure compliance with environmental regulations.
